Introduction to AI-Powered Marketing Dashboards

Understanding the Basics

AI-powered marketing dashboards are revolutionizing the way businesses approach data analytics and reporting. At their core, these dashboards leverage artificial intelligence to collect, process, and visualize data in a user-friendly format. Unlike traditional dashboards, which often require manual data entry and interpretation, AI-powered versions automate these processes, reducing human error and saving valuable time. By utilizing machine learning algorithms, these dashboards can identify patterns and trends that might be missed by the human eye, providing deeper and more actionable insights. This foundational understanding sets the stage for exploring the more advanced features and benefits of AI-powered marketing dashboards.

How AI Enhances Data Accuracy

AI enhances data accuracy by automating the data collection process, thereby minimizing human error. Traditional data collection methods often involve manual input, which can lead to inconsistencies and inaccuracies due to human oversight or fatigue. AI-powered systems, however, can automatically gather data from various sources, ensuring that the information is captured consistently and accurately. These systems use advanced algorithms to validate and cross-check data in real-time, flagging any discrepancies for further review. As a result, businesses can trust that the data they are working with is both accurate and reliable, forming a solid foundation for their marketing strategies.

Another way AI improves data accuracy is through advanced data cleaning techniques. Data cleaning is a critical step in ensuring the quality of the data, but it can be time-consuming and complex when done manually. AI algorithms can efficiently identify and correct errors, such as duplicates, missing values, and outliers, that could otherwise skew analysis results. These algorithms can also standardize data formats and ensure that all entries adhere to predefined rules, further enhancing the consistency and reliability of the dataset. By automating the data cleaning process, AI not only saves time but also significantly improves the overall quality of the data, leading to more accurate and meaningful insights.

AI’s ability to perform real-time data validation and anomaly detection is another crucial factor in enhancing data accuracy. Machine learning models can continuously monitor incoming data for any irregularities or deviations from expected patterns. When an anomaly is detected, the system can alert users immediately, allowing for prompt investigation and correction. This real-time monitoring ensures that any potential issues are addressed before they can impact the overall dataset. Moreover, AI systems can learn from these anomalies, improving their accuracy and effectiveness over time. This continuous improvement cycle ensures that the data remains accurate and reliable, providing a robust basis for decision-making and strategic planning.

Role-Based Access and Custom Views

Another important aspect of customizing dashboards is the ability to create role-based access and custom views. Different team members may require access to different sets of data based on their roles and responsibilities. AI-powered dashboards can be configured to provide tailored views for various user groups, ensuring that each team member sees the information most relevant to their tasks. For example, a marketing manager might need a high-level overview of campaign performance, while a data analyst might require more granular data. Role-based access controls ensure that sensitive information is only accessible to authorized personnel, enhancing data security while providing a personalized user experience.

Interactive and Dynamic Elements

Incorporating interactive and dynamic elements into your dashboards is another way to customize them to meet your needs. AI-powered dashboards can feature interactive components such as drill-down capabilities, filters, and real-time updates, allowing users to explore the data in greater depth. These dynamic elements enable users to manipulate the data on the fly, gaining new insights and perspectives without needing to generate separate reports. For instance, users can apply filters to view data for specific time periods, regions, or customer segments, making it easier to identify trends and patterns. This level of interactivity ensures that the dashboard remains a valuable tool for ongoing analysis and decision-making, adapting to the evolving needs of the business.

Common Challenges and Solutions

Data Integration Issues

One common challenge businesses face when implementing AI-powered dashboards is data integration issues. Many organizations use a variety of tools and platforms to collect and manage data, leading to fragmented and siloed information. This fragmentation can make it difficult to consolidate data into a unified dashboard. The solution lies in leveraging robust APIs and data connectors that facilitate seamless integration between different systems. AI-powered dashboards often come with customizable API connections that can be tailored to fit the specific needs of the organization. By setting up these connections, businesses can ensure that data flows smoothly from all sources into the dashboard, providing a comprehensive and accurate view of marketing performance.

User Adoption and Training

User adoption and training are critical challenges when introducing AI-powered dashboards to a team. Even the most advanced dashboard can be underutilized if team members are not comfortable using it. To address this, businesses should invest in comprehensive training programs that cover both the technical aspects of the dashboard and its practical applications. Hands-on workshops, online tutorials, and ongoing support can help users become more proficient and confident in using the tool. Additionally, involving key stakeholders in the implementation process can foster a sense of ownership and encourage wider adoption. By ensuring that all team members are well-trained and understand the value of the AI dashboard, businesses can maximize its impact and improve overall efficiency.

Data Privacy and Security Concerns

Data privacy and security concerns are paramount when integrating AI-powered dashboards, especially given the sensitivity of marketing and customer data. Businesses must ensure that their dashboard solutions comply with relevant data protection regulations, such as GDPR or CCPA. Implementing robust security measures, such as encryption, access controls, and regular security audits, can help safeguard data against unauthorized access and breaches. Additionally, working with reputable AI dashboard providers that prioritize data security can offer an added layer of protection. Clear communication with stakeholders about the measures in place to protect data can also help alleviate concerns and build trust. By addressing privacy and security issues proactively, businesses can confidently leverage AI-powered dashboards while maintaining the integrity and confidentiality of their data.
